People who are prone to getting cavities should choose a mouthwash that contains fluoride. One of the things you need to avoid, especially if you have braces, is mouthwash products that contain alcohol. The alcohol in these products can actually dry out your mouth, which only contributes to tooth decay and bad breath.Should I use mouthwash after brushing with braces?

How many times a day should I use mouthwash with braces?
Use mouthwash once a day before bed. Mouthwash has to be alcohol free and contain Fluoride. (Alcohol can weaken the rubber components used on your brace). The reason bad breath is more common with braces is that the hardware of braces makes it easier for tiny particles of food to get trapped underneath the brackets and wires. These foods are broken down by bacteria, and a by-product of that process is an unpleasant smell: halitosis, or bad breath.Can I use whitening toothpaste with braces?
While your braces are on, don't use whitening products including whitening toothpaste or whitening mouthwash. The whitening agent only works on the place it touches, so wait until your braces are off before whitening or your teeth color will be uneven.Why are teeth sensitive with braces?

What's the average time you wear braces?
On average, it takes about 24 months to complete an orthodontic treatment. Some patients require less than 12 months, but there are also patients requiring up to 3 years of treatment before their teeth reach the desired position. Orthodontics is not a one-size-fits-all solution and each patient's mouth is unique.Do you have to floss every time you eat with braces?
